Output cfc459e3b145b26ae5e81ab6d275364e4599a020b7fa7355e41d971bfc1d103b:0

value
22940325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 985bf8313de70e32f5bf5b7d389c3b0ec041130b OP_EQUAL
address
3FacorYLZG87YmveJab76EXv6RoQj3a9u2
transaction
cfc459e3b145b26ae5e81ab6d275364e4599a020b7fa7355e41d971bfc1d103b
confirmations
281374
spent
true